Hard Shell vs. Soft Silicone: Which Actually Saves Your Screen?

That sound. The dull crack of glass meeting pavement. You flip your phone over and see the spider web spreading across your screen. It's the worst feeling, and it happens fast.

Most people reach for the hardest case they can find after a crack, assuming rigid means safe. That instinct is wrong, and it's costing people screens. The material on the back of your case matters far less than you think. What actually determines whether your screen survives is shock dispersion and one measurement most people ignore entirely: the bezel lip.

The Hard Shell: Polycarbonate

Hard shell cases are made from polycarbonate (PC) — the same rigid plastic used in safety goggles and bulletproof glass composites. They're slim, glossy, and feel substantial in your hand. They also look great because PC takes high-resolution printing beautifully.

Here's the physics problem: polycarbonate has high stiffness and almost zero flex. When it hits the ground, the energy from the impact doesn't get absorbed — it travels straight through the case and into your phone's glass. It's like wearing a suit of armor with no padding underneath. The armor might survive, but the person inside gets the full force.

There's a second problem. Many hard shell cases are snap-on designs. On a hard enough impact, the case can pop off entirely, leaving your phone naked for the second bounce. You've seen it happen: phone bounces once, case flies off, phone hits the ground again unprotected.

Where hard shells win: scratch resistance. If keys and coins in your purse are your main concern, polycarbonate handles that well. But for drops? It's the wrong tool.

The Soft Shell: Silicone

Silicone cases are the opposite extreme. They're squishy, grippy, and flexible. When your phone hits the ground, silicone compresses and absorbs the initial blow like dropping an egg onto a pillow.

For everyday fumbles — slipping off a nightstand, falling off your lap — silicone does a decent job. But it has two failure modes that matter:

Bottoming out. Drop your phone from ear height or off a balcony, and the silicone compresses fully. Once it's fully compressed, there's nothing left to absorb. The remaining force passes directly into your phone. The cushion runs out.

Loose lips. Silicone stretches over time, especially around the edges. After a few months of daily use, the fit loosens. During a drop, those soft edges peel back from the phone, exposing the screen corners to direct contact with the ground. Corners are where the vast majority of screen cracks start.

And then there's the lint factor. Silicone is essentially a dust magnet. Pull your phone out of a purse or pocket and it comes out covered in fuzz, hair, and crumbs. For anyone who cares about how their phone looks, that's a dealbreaker.

The Real Winner: TPU Hybrids

Thermoplastic Polyurethane sits in the middle ground — and that's exactly where protection lives.

TPU is hard enough to maintain its shape and keep a firm grip on your phone. It won't peel away during a drop, and it won't stretch out over months of use. But it's soft enough to flex on impact, absorbing the shockwave and dispersing it away from your screen instead of transmitting it through.

The secret weapon in the best TPU cases is corner air pockets — tiny gaps engineered into the internal corners of the case. These work exactly like the air units in running shoes. When the corner hits the ground (which is where 90% of drops land), the air pocket compresses first, absorbing the energy before it reaches the phone. Once the impact passes, the pocket returns to its original shape, ready for the next drop.

The Bezel Rule: The Only Measurement That Matters

Here's the truth that case marketing doesn't want to talk about: it doesn't matter if your case is made of titanium or jelly if the screen touches the ground first.

The raised bezel — that lip around the edge of your case — is what keeps your screen suspended above the surface when your phone lands face-down. Without enough bezel height, the screen contacts the ground directly, and no amount of shock absorption will save it.

Look for a bezel of 1.5mm to 2mm. Anything less and you're taking a gamble.

The coin test: Place your phone face-down on a flat surface. Try to slide a coin under the screen. If the coin touches the glass, your case doesn't have enough bezel and your screen is at risk. A proper case creates a visible gap between the screen and the surface.

The same applies to the camera module. Your rear cameras sit on a raised bump, and without a protective ring extending above them, every time you set your phone down on a table, the lenses are grinding against the surface.

Which One Should You Buy?

If thinness is your only priority: A hard shell will give you the slimmest profile. Just understand that you're trading away almost all drop protection. One bad fall and you're buying a new screen.

If you want the best grip and tactile feel: Silicone delivers that satisfying squishy texture. Keep a lint roller in your bag, and consider replacing the case every few months when it starts to stretch.

If you want to actually protect your screen: Get a TPU hybrid with a raised bezel. It's the only material that absorbs shock, holds its shape, and keeps the screen off the ground.
